This is looking for the Visual Studio 2008 c-runtime merge
modules. Visual Studio 2010 would be VC100. Where did you get the WiX input files? did you extract them from the HTCondor .ZIP file from our website? The WiX input files from the .ZIP file on our website were built using Visual Studio 2008 and thus require the VC90 runtime merge modules. If you had actually built HTCondor using Visual Studio 2010, then I would expect the WiX input files to be lookin for "VC_CRT_MSM Microsoft_VC100_CRT_x86.msm" instead. See the file build\cmake\CondorPackageConfig.cmake at about line 210 to see how this gets configured. -tj On 8/21/2013 11:21 PM, Kevin Buckley
